- What education and/or training do you have that relates to your work?
Our founder is a Professional Member of the National Association of Senior & Specialty Move Managers (NASMM) and has completed NASMM's Cornerstone training in safety, ethics, moving industry fundamentals, and contracts and liability, as well as the Front Door Senior Move Management training program. She also brings more than 25 years of executive leadership and project management experience, guiding individuals and families through significant life transitions while coordinating complex logistics and communicating with multiple stakeholders. This combination of specialized training and extensive professional experience enables us to provide thoughtful, organized, and compassionate support throughout every transition.
